Emery-Nosler Switches to Ford Lines in Portland Showroom

Emery-Nosler will drop Willys Knight and Overland agencies to sell Ford products. They plan a full Ford parts and machinery line for repairs, stock Ford cars including tractors and trucks, and specialize in Ford service. The Fugate building is being fitted as a showroom with displays next week. Nosler met with Ford officials in Portland to align on policy.

Shipment of 91000 pounds bark to eastern market

E J Michael shipped a car of 91000 pounds of cascara bark to the eastern market this week marking the second shipment of the season. Earlier a half car load went out and another carload is expected later this month at eight cents per pound.

Endicott 60th Wedding Anniversary Celebrated at Myrtle Point

Mr and Mrs Endicott of Myrtle Point celebrated sixty years of marriage with relatives and friends gathering at Whigher grove on the Coquille river for a picnic and reunion. Attendees included J S Lyons and family W H Lyons C M Johnson and daughter Alyce Dell Rev and Mrs W E Cooper and daughter Beatrice and several Endicott relatives from multiple cities. The couple traveled from Missouri to San Francisco then to Coos Bay by Empire and settled on a homestead on the middle fork of the Coquille before moving to Myrtle Point in 1912. Mrs Endicott born Deliah Crawford and Mr Endicott a Civil War veteran of Missouri volunteers.

First Airmail Arrives in Myrtle Point for Miss Louise Schmitt

The first trans continental aerial mail to reach Myrtle Point arrived last Monday for Miss Louise Schmitt visiting her brother GC E arwha PM lebbae wee mallad at SComne. It left Atchison Kansas on the 7th and arrived in Myrtle Point on the 10th via San Francisco. The postage rate was five cents.

Young John Henry Ogden Dies After Illness in 1924

John Henry Ogden born San Jose November 12 1902 died Sunday August 10 1924 at 21 years 8 months 28 days after acute neuritis illness. He leaves mother stepfather two sisters and six half siblings. Funeral at Ellingsen chapel Coquille August 12 1924 with Elder Thomas Barklow officiating. Interment J C O F cemetery Coquille.
